I did a new installation of karmic alfa6. Its been a lot of udates since then and even a couple of kernel updates. Grub has automatically been updated and has started from the latest installed kernel, for exampel there was no problem with the update to kernel 2.6.31-12.
The problem occured after updating to kernel 2.6.31-13. I am pretty sure that the packakge "grub" was the one installed from the start. The fault could be that the wrong grub was installed from the beginning (karmic alfa6) or it may have been that the updater should have unistalled grub and installed grub-pc instead. The problem was solved when I manually uninstalled grub and instead installed grub-pc. After that I could run command update-grub2 and grub started with the new kernel.
